📋 Description

• Support Neuromodulation Pain and Target Drug Delivery Therapies through surgical coverage, follow-up support, troubleshooting, customer service, and education • Represent Medtronic during surgical procedures by ensuring equipment and products are available • Provide technical support, device selection, programming, and testing of device systems • Manage patients through all phases of the clinical process and educate them on Medtronic products • Provide clinical support in surgeries, re-programmings, troubleshooting, and follow-ups in hospitals and clinics • Respond to technical inquiries from customers, patients, and colleagues • Maintain knowledge of competitive products • Educate and train physicians, hospital personnel, and office staff through teaching sessions, in-services, programs, seminars, and symposia • Assist Management and Sales Training with training new district employees • Complete event reporting and documentation using Medtronic technology tools • Place customer service orders for pending purchase orders and product replacement • Work with materials management to collect purchase orders for covered cases • Manage territory/district inventory, including transactions, cycle counts, product retrievals, and expiration/hold controls • Contribute to quarterly district, regional, and national initiatives • Partner with sales representatives to achieve territory/district business goals and document quarterly activities • Visit accounts to replenish literature and maintain office staff relationships • Use Excel, mobile phones, iPads, laptops, and/or Samsung tablets • Manage business expenses and budgets • Complete therapy, compliance, and other required training • Travel within the district and occasionally to other districts to cover cases

🎯 Requirements

• High School Diploma or GED with a minimum 4 years of clinical or medical sales experience; or Associate Degree with a minimum 2 years of clinical or medical sales experience; or Bachelor’s degree • Preferred: Bachelor's degree in a health care related field • Preferred: Registered nurse or HCP with experience in a sterile environment • Preferred: Clinical experience with implantable neurological products and patient care • Preferred: Experience servicing medical personnel on product use • Preferred: Experience with a medical device company or pharmaceutical company and clinical experience in neurology, neurosurgery, orthopedic, operating room, pain management, or home health care • Preferred: Understanding of basic reimbursement and healthcare environment • Excellent organizational skills and ability to work under pressure • Must reside within the territory • Valid driver's license and active vehicle insurance policy • Unrestricted U.S. work authorization at the time of hire and for the duration of employment • Ability to function using healthcare universal precautions • Ability to work weekends, evenings, nights, and travel overnight when required • Ability to attend national and district meetings and training • Ability to wear a 7–9 lbs protective lead apron for extended periods • Ability to lift up to 40 lbs • Ability to sit, stand, and/or walk for 8+ hours per day • Ability to bend/stoop, squat, and balance frequently • Specific vision abilities including close vision, distance vision, depth perception, and focus adjustment • Ability to drive approximately 50% of the time within the assigned territory • For foreign baccalaureate degrees, degree must satisfy 8 C.F.R. § 214.2(h)(4)(iii)(A)
